공공데이터 AI 활용 방법 | 3가지 단계로 끝내는 핵심 정리 가이드

방대한 양의 공공데이터를 어떻게 인공지능에 연결해야 할지 고민하고 계셨나요? 공공데이터 AI 활용 방법은 정부나 공공기관이 개방한 숫자와 정보들을 인공지능 학습용 데이터셋, 즉 AI가 공부하기 좋은 맞춤형 자료로 바꾸는 과정을 말해요. 이 과정이 중요한 이유는 정확한 기초 자료를 사용해야만 우리가 원하는 똑똑한 AI 서비스를 만들 수 있기 때문이에요. 이 글을 읽으시면 복잡한 데이터를 손쉽게 수집하고 인공지능 모델에 적용하는 구체적인 순서를 배우게 됩니다. 전문적인 지식이 없어도 차근차근 따라오시면 누구나 자신만의 데이터를 구축할 수 있어요. 이 글을 끝까지 읽으면 공공데이터 AI 활용 방법을 완벽하게 마스터하고 실무에 바로 적용할 수 있어요.

아래 버튼을 통해, 지금 바로 해보세요!

공공데이터 AI 활용 방법, 성공적인 시작을 위한 3가지 핵심 정리

빅데이터 시대가 도래하면서 정부가 개방한 방대한 자료를 일컫는 공공데이터 AI 활용 방법은 이제 선택이 아닌 필수가 되었습니다. 공공데이터 AI 활용 방법이란 국가 기관이나 지자체에서 생성한 공공 정보를 이 학습하기 좋은 형태로 가공하여 새로운 서비스나 예측 모델을 만드는 과정을 의미합니다. 쉽게 말해, 나라에서 모아둔 거대한 도서관의 책들을 이라는 똑똑한 비서가 읽기 편하도록 요약 노트를 만들어 주는 것과 비슷합니다.

우리가 일상에서 흔히 사용하는 미세먼지 예측 앱이나 버스 도착 정보 서비스도 모두 공공데이터 AI 활용 방법의 결과물입니다. 과거에는 단순히 숫자를 보여주는 데 그쳤다면, 이제는 이 이 데이터들을 학습하여 내일의 공기 질을 예측하거나 교통 체증을 미리 알려주는 수준까지 발전했습니다. 이러한 방식은 초기 데이터 수집 비용을 획기적으로 줄여주기 때문에 예산이 부족한 스타트업이나 개인 개발자들에게 엄청난 기회를 제공합니다.

공공데이터 AI 활용 방법이 중요한 이유는 데이터의 신뢰도에 있습니다. 개인이 수집한 정보와 달리 국가가 검증한 공신력 있는 자료를 기반으로 하므로, 모델의 정확도가 매우 높습니다. 예를 들어 기상청의 날씨 데이터를 학습시킨 AI는 일반적인 관측 장비보다 훨씬 정밀한 농작물 수확 시기 예측이 가능해집니다. 이는 마치 전교 1등의 필기 노트를 빌려 공부하는 것과 같은 효과를 냅니다.

실제로 공공데이터 AI 활용 방법을 적용할 때는 ‘API’라는 도구를 자주 사용합니다. API는 ‘응용 프로그램 인터페이스’의 약자로, 서로 다른 소프트웨어가 대화를 나눌 수 있게 해주는 통로입니다. 은 이 통로를 통해 실시간으로 변하는 공공 데이터를 실시간으로 받아와 스스로 학습을 이어갑니다. 만약 전통적인 방식이었다면 일일이 엑셀 파일을 내려받아야 했겠지만, AI 활용 공공데이터 환경에서는 모든 과정이 자동화됩니다.

비즈니스 측면에서도 공공데이터 AI 활용 방법은 강력한 무기가 됩니다. 상권 분석 데이터를 활용해 으로 창업 성공률을 점치거나, 의료 데이터를 분석해 질병 발생 위험도를 낮추는 서비스 등이 대표적입니다. 이처럼 공공의 이익을 위해 개방된 자원을 기술과 결합하는 능력은 디지털 전환 시대의 핵심 역량으로 자리 잡았습니다.

그렇다면 구체적으로 어떤 데이터를 어디서 가져와야 효율적일까요? 무작정 많은 데이터를 넣는다고 AI가 똑똑해지는 것은 아닙니다. 목적에 맞는 데이터를 선별하고 이를 정제하는 단계가 반드시 필요합니다. 이어지는 내용에서는 초보자도 바로 따라 할 수 있는 데이터 수집 채널과 구체적인 분석 도구 활용법에 대해 자세히 알아보겠습니다.

성공적인 공공데이터 AI 활용 방법을 위한 3가지 실전 전략과 주의사항

앞서 개념을 잡았다면 이제는 실전입니다. 효과적인 공공데이터 AI 활용 방법은 단순히 데이터를 수집하는 것을 넘어, 목적에 맞는 데이터를 선별하고 모델이 학습하기 가장 좋은 형태로 정제하는 전략적 접근이 핵심입니다. 이 과정을 제대로 이해하면 데이터 처리 시간을 50% 이상 단축하면서도 결과물의 정확도는 획기적으로 높일 수 있습니다.

가장 먼저 고려해야 할 전략은 데이터의 최신성 확보입니다. 공공데이터포털(data.go.kr)에서 제공하는 데이터 중에는 일회성 파일도 있지만, 실시간으로 업데이트되는 API 형태가 많습니다. 모델이 과거의 정보에 머물지 않도록 자동화된 수집 체계를 구축하는 것이 공공데이터 AI 활용 방법의 첫 단추입니다. 이는 마치 매일 아침 배달되는 신선한 식재료로 요리를 하는 것과 같습니다.

두 번째는 데이터 전처리 단계의 정밀함입니다. 공공기관의 자료는 형식이 제각각인 경우가 많아, 이 이해할 수 있는 표준 규격(JSON, CSV 등)으로 변환하는 작업이 필수적입니다. 이때 데이터 내의 빈값(결측치)을 어떻게 처리하느냐에 따라 AI의 판단력이 달라집니다. 잘못된 데이터 하나가 전체 학습 결과를 망칠 수 있으므로, 데이터 청소 과정에 가장 많은 공을 들여야 합니다.

실제 예시를 들어보겠습니다. 최근 유행하는 ‘AI 기반 맞춤형 영양 관리 서비스’는 공공데이터 AI 활용 방법의 대표적 사례입니다. 식약처에서 제공하는 공공 음식 영양 성분 데이터를 에 학습시킨 뒤, 사용자가 찍은 음식 사진을 분석하여 칼로리를 계산해 줍니다. 만약 이때 공공데이터의 수치 단위가 틀렸거나 데이터가 누락되었다면 AI는 사용자에게 잘못된 건강 조언을 하게 됩니다.

여기서 반드시 주의해야 할 점이 있습니다. 바로 라이선스와 저작권 확인입니다. 모든 공공데이터가 상업적으로 이용 가능한 것은 아닙니다. ‘공공누리’ 표시를 확인하여 상업적 이용 가능 여부와 출처 표시 의무를 반드시 체크해야 합니다. 이를 무시하고 서비스를 출시했다가는 법적 분쟁에 휘말릴 위험이 큽니다. 또한, 데이터의 편향성도 경계해야 합니다. 특정 지역이나 계층에 치우친 공공데이터를 학습하면 AI가 차별적인 결과를 내놓을 수 있기 때문입니다.

결국 성공적인 공공데이터 AI 활용 방법은 기술적인 구현 능력만큼이나 데이터를 바라보는 분석적인 시각이 중요합니다. 어떤 데이터를 조합했을 때 새로운 가치가 창출될지 고민하는 과정이 선행되어야 합니다. 데이터의 바다에서 보석을 찾아내어 AI라는 강력한 엔진에 공급하는 일, 그것이 바로 여러분이 해야 할 핵심 역할입니다.

이러한 기초 전략을 바탕으로 나만의 AI 서비스를 기획하고 계신가요? 지금 바로 실전에 활용할 수 있는 유용한 팁들을 아래에서 추가로 확인해 보세요.

실수 없는 공공데이터 AI 활용 방법을 위한 핵심 최적화 체크리스트

성공적인 공공데이터 AI 활용 방법의 마지막 단계는 데이터의 품질을 유지하고 모델의 효율성을 극대화하는 최적화 전략에 있습니다. 단순히 데이터를 입력하는 단계를 넘어, 학습 효율을 높이는 데이터 선별 기술과 운영 비용을 절감하는 구조적 설계가 뒷받침되어야 합니다. 이 과정을 소홀히 하면 아무리 양질의 데이터를 사용하더라도 이 엉뚱한 결과를 내놓는 ‘가비지 인, 가비지 아웃(Garbage In, Garbage Out)’ 현상을 겪게 됩니다.

심화 과정에서 가장 중요한 것은 데이터의 ‘차원 축소’와 ‘특징 추출’입니다. 공공기관에서 제공하는 원본 데이터에는 학습에 불필요한 행정 정보나 중복된 항목이 포함되어 있는 경우가 많습니다. 공공데이터 AI 활용 방법 최적화의 핵심은 모델 성능에 직접적인 영향을 주는 핵심 변수만을 골라내는 것입니다. 이를 통해 의 연산 속도는 높이고 서버 비용은 획기적으로 낮출 수 있습니다. 마치 두꺼운 백과사전에서 시험에 나올 핵심 요점만 골라 단권화 노트를 만드는 것과 같습니다.

실제 성공 사례와 실패 사례를 비교해 보겠습니다. 한 스타트업은 전국 전통시장 가격 데이터를 활용해 물가 예측 AI를 만들었습니다. 처음에는 모든 품목의 데이터를 무차별적으로 입력했으나 예측 정확도가 60%대에 머물렀습니다. 하지만 공공데이터 AI 활용 방법 전략을 수정하여 계절성 요인과 지역별 특성 데이터에 가중치를 부여하자 정확도가 90%까지 상승했습니다. 반면, 데이터의 업데이트 주기를 고려하지 않고 과거의 고정된 파일 데이터만 고집한 업체는 실시간 물가 변동을 반영하지 못해 서비스 신뢰도를 잃고 말았습니다.

흔히 범하는 치명적인 실수는 데이터의 ‘편향성’을 간과하는 것입니다. 특정 지역의 공공데이터만 집중적으로 학습시키면 은 그 지역의 특성이 전체의 표준인 것처럼 오해하게 됩니다. 예를 들어 서울의 교통 데이터만 학습한 자율주행 알고리즘은 지방의 비포장도로나 특수한 교차로 환경에서 제대로 작동하지 않을 수 있습니다. 따라서 공공데이터 AI 활용 방법 시에는 다양한 출처의 데이터를 균형 있게 배합하는 ‘데이터 셔플링’ 기술이 반드시 동반되어야 합니다.

또한, 데이터 보안과 개인정보 비식별화 조치도 놓쳐서는 안 될 체크포인트입니다. 공공데이터 자체는 익명화되어 있지만, 여러 데이터를 결합하는 과정에서 특정 개인을 식별할 수 있는 정보가 생성될 위험이 있습니다. 모델이 학습 과정에서 민감한 정보를 암기하지 않도록 차분 프라이버시(Differential Privacy)와 같은 최신 기술을 적용하는 것이 안전한 활용의 지름길입니다.

마지막으로 지속 가능한 운영을 위해 ‘데이터 드리프트(Data Drift)’ 현상을 감시해야 합니다. 시간이 흐름에 따라 실제 세상의 데이터 분포가 변하면 학습된 AI의 성능도 자연스럽게 떨어집니다. 공공데이터 AI 활용 방법은 한 번의 설정으로 끝나는 것이 아니라, 정기적인 데이터 재학습과 모델 튜닝이 반복되는 순환 구조로 설계되어야 합니다. 이러한 체계적인 관리가 뒷받침될 때 비로소 강력하고 신뢰받는 서비스를 완성할 수 있습니다.

이제 여러분은 공공데이터를 활용한 AI 구축의 모든 핵심 전략을 파악했습니다. 더 구체적인 기술 스택과 도구 선택이 고민된다면 아래의 실전 가이드를 통해 다음 단계로 나아가 보세요.

공공데이터 AI 활용 방법 데이터 획득 방식별 비교
항목 오픈 API 실시간 연동 방식 대용량 파일 다운로드 방식 빅데이터 플랫폼 분석 환경
데이터 업데이트 기관 서버와 동기화되어 실시간으로 최신 정보가 반영됩니다. 사용자가 수동으로 파일을 내려받은 시점의 데이터에 고정됩니다. 플랫폼 내에서 정기적으로 갱신되는 적재 데이터를 활용합니다.
기술적 난이도 HTTP 통신과 JSON 파싱 등 중급 이상의 개발 역량이 필요합니다. 엑셀이나 CSV 파일을 다룰 줄 안다면 초보자도 바로 가능합니다. 해당 플랫폼 전용 분석 도구와 SQL 등에 대한 숙련도가 필요합니다.
적합한 서비스 버스 도착 정보, 날씨 알림 등 실시간성이 중요한 앱에 적합합니다. 과거 추이 분석이나 모델의 초기 대량 학습에 유리합니다. 여러 기관의 데이터를 결합하여 고차원 통계를 내는 연구에 쓰입니다.

Q1. 초보자가 공공데이터 AI 활용 방법을 시작할 때 가장 먼저 해야 할 일은 무엇인가요?

A1. 가장 먼저 자신이 만들고자 하는 서비스의 목적을 명확히 하고 그에 맞는 데이터를 찾는 것이 순서입니다. 공공데이터포털에서 제공하는 수많은 자료 중 AI 학습에 적합한 수치형 데이터인지, 혹은 텍스트나 이미지 형태인지 확인해야 합니다. 무작정 데이터를 내려받기보다는 공공데이터 AI 활용 방법 데이터셋 검색 기능을 통해 활용 사례를 먼저 찾아보세요. 예를 들어 미세먼지 예측 AI를 만든다면 과거 기상 데이터와 유동 인구 데이터를 결합하는 기획부터 시작하는 것이 시행착오를 줄이는 지름길입니다.

Q2. 공공데이터 AI 활용 방법 과정에서 데이터 정제 작업이 왜 그렇게 중요한가요?

A2. 공공기관의 데이터는 입력 형식이나 단위가 통일되지 않은 경우가 많아 이를 그대로 AI에 학습시키면 오류가 발생하기 때문입니다. 날짜 형식이 다르거나 측정값이 누락된 결측치를 적절히 처리하지 않으면 의 판단력이 흐려집니다. 데이터 정제는 이 정보를 오해하지 않도록 깨끗하게 닦아주는 과정과 같습니다. 실제 예로 주소 데이터의 경우 지번 주소와 도로명 주소를 하나로 통일하는 작업이 필수적입니다. 더 상세한 기법은 공공데이터 AI 활용 방법 데이터 정제 가이드에서 확인하여 모델의 정확도를 높여보시기 바랍니다.

Q3. 공공데이터 AI 활용 방법 시 저작권이나 라이선스 위반을 피하는 방법이 궁금해요.

A3. 공공데이터라고 해서 무조건 상업적 이용이 가능한 것은 아니므로 반드시 ‘공공누리’ 유형을 확인해야 합니다. 대부분은 출처만 밝히면 자유롭게 이용할 수 있는 제1유형이지만, 제2유형부터는 상업적 이용이 금지되거나 제3유형처럼 내용 변경이 불가능한 경우도 있습니다. 학습용으로 데이터를 변형할 때 이 라이선스 규정을 어기면 법적 책임을 질 수 있습니다. 따라서 서비스를 출시하기 전 공공데이터 AI 활용 방법 라이선스 구분 확인을 통해 자신의 사업 모델이 규정에 부합하는지 꼼꼼히 대조해 보는 과정이 반드시 필요합니다.

Q4. 공공데이터 AI 활용 방법을 적용한 서비스의 수익 창출은 어떻게 이루어지나요?

A4. 주로 공공데이터의 접근성을 높이거나 이를 가공하여 새로운 가치를 제공함으로써 수익을 냅니다. 예를 들어 여러 기관에 흩어진 부동산 매물 정보와 학군 데이터를 결합하여 맞춤형 추천을 해주는 의 가치가 충분히 발생합니다.

Q5. 공공데이터 AI 활용 방법에서 API 호출 횟수 제한 문제는 어떻게 해결하나요?

A5. 대부분의 공공 데이터 API는 일일 호출 한도가 정해져 있어 이용자가 급증하면 서비스가 중단될 위험이 있습니다. 이를 해결하기 위해서는 ‘캐싱(Caching)’ 기술을 활용하여 한 번 불러온 데이터를 일정 시간 동안 저장해 두고 재사용하는 전략이 필요합니다. 또한 트래픽이 꾸준히 늘어난다면 정식으로 운영 신청을 하여 한도를 증설받아야 합니다. 시스템 설계를 시작할 때 공공데이터 AI 활용 방법 API 한도 증설 신청 절차를 미리 숙지해 두면 서비스 확장 단계에서 발생하는 병목 현상을 유연하게 대처할 수 있습니다.